You are on page 1of 5

KURIKULUM SMK Pasundan Cilamaya

NAMA SEKOLAH MATA PELAJARAN KELAS/SEMESTER STANDAR KOMPETENSI KODE KOMPETENSI ALOKASI WAKTU KOMPETENSI DASAR
1. Menggunakan TSQL

: : : : : :

SMK Pasundan Cilamaya Kompetensi Kejuruan

SILABUS

Membuat program basis data menggunakan Microsoft (SQL Server) TIK.PR08.005.01 60 X 45 Menit ALOKASI WAKTU KEGIATAN PEMBELAJARAN
Menggunakan mrograman untuk SQL Server Menggunakan Sintaks TSQL Menjalankan perintah TSQL dijalankan

MATERI PEMBELAJARAN
Alat-alat pemrograman untuk SQL Server Sintaks TSQL. Perintah TSQL

INDIKATOR
Alat-alat pemrograman untuk SQL Server digunakan. Sintaks TSQL digunakan. Perintah TSQL dijalankan Stored procedures dimanipulasi (dibuat, modifikasi, dan hapus) . Programming stored procedures dibuat. Triggers dibuat dan dikelola. Programming triggers dibuat.

PENILAIAN
Program sederhana Pengamatan Tes tertulis Tugas Hasil program

TM
4

PS
4 (8)

PI
4 (16)

SUMBER BELAJAR
Manual SQL 2000 server Pengembangan database dengan SQL Server Komputer

2. Menggunakan stored procedures

Stored procedures (dibuat, modifikasi, dan hapus) . Programming stored procedures.

Memanioulasi Stored procedures (dibuat, modifikasi, dan hapus) . Membuat Programming stored procedures dibuat.

Program sederhana Pengamatan Tes tertulis Tugas Hasil program

4 (8)

4 (16)

Manual SQL 2000 server Pengembangan database dengan SQL Server Komputer

3. Menggunakan triggers

Triggers.

Membuat Triggers Mengelola Triggers. Membuat basis data dengan menggunakan Programming triggers dibuat.

Programming triggers.

Program sederhana Pengamatan Tes tertulis Tugas Hasil program

4 (8)

4 (16)

Manual SQL 2000 server Pengembangan database dengan SQL Server Komputer

PROGRAM KEAHLIAN : REKAYASA PERANGKAT LUNAK

SILABUS KOMPETENSI KEJURUAN Halaman 1 dari 5

KURIKULUM SMK Pasundan Cilamaya

KOMPETENSI DASAR
4. Menerapkan Administrasi SQL Server

MATERI PEMBELAJARAN
Sistem keamanan untuk SQL Server Keamanan SQL Server

ALOKASI WAKTU KEGIATAN PEMBELAJARAN


Membuat sistem keamanan untuk SQL Server Mengimplementasikan dan Mengadministrasikan Sistem Keamanan SQL Server

INDIKATOR
Sistem keamanan untuk SQL Server dibuat dan dirancang. Keamanan SQL Server diimplementasikan dan diadministrasikan Konsep SQL Server Agent dije-laskan Konsep DTS (Data Transformation Service) dijelaskan Integrasi dari sistem dan transfer data menggunakan XML dilakukan

PENILAIAN
Program sederhana Pengamatan Tes tertulis Tugas Hasil program

TM
4

PS
4 (8)

PI
4 (16)

SUMBER BELAJAR
Manual SQL 2000 server Pengembangan database dengan SQL Server Komputer

Konsep SQL Server Agent Konsep DTS (Data Transforma-tion Service)

Menjelaskan konsep SQL Server Agent Konsep DTS (Data Transforma-tion Service)

5. Menerapkan XML support

Integrasi dari sistem dan transfer data menggunakan XML

Melakukan Integrasi dari sistem dan transfer data menggunakan XML support

Program sederhana Pengamatan Tes tertulis Tugas Hasil program

4 (8)

4 (16)

Manual SQL 2000 server Pengembangan database dengan SQL Server E-book XML Komputer

PROGRAM KEAHLIAN : REKAYASA PERANGKAT LUNAK

SILABUS KOMPETENSI KEJURUAN Halaman 2 dari 5

KURIKULUM SMK Pasundan Cilamaya

NAMA SEKOLAH MATA PELAJARAN KELAS/SEMESTER STANDAR KOMPETENSI KODE KOMPETENSI ALOKASI WAKTU KOMPETENSI DASAR
1. Menerapkan Oracle tingkat Dasar

: : : : :

SMK Pasundan Cilamaya Kompetensi Kejuruan


: Membuat program basis data menggunakan PL/SQL (Oracle) TIK.PR08.005.01

36 X 45 Menit ALOKASI WAKTU KEGIATAN PEMBELAJARAN


. Membuat Sub-queries dan corelated queries. Menjelaskan Ekstensi dari DML (Data Manipulation Language) dan DDL (Data Definition Language) Fitur-fitur dan perintah dalam SQL*plus digunakan MenggunakanPerintah manipulasi data dan kontrol data. dictionary. Menjelaskan Locking. MenjelaskanObyek-obyek Oracle (Views, clusters, indexes, synonyms, snapshots) Melakukan Restriksi, sorting, rules, defaults dan constraining data

MATERI PEMBELAJARAN
Restriksi, sorting, rules, defaults dan constraining data. Sub-queries dan corelated queries. Ekstensi dari DML (Data Manipulation Language) dan DDL (Data Definition Language). Fitur-fitur dan perintah dalam SQL*plus digunakan Perintah manipulasi data dan kontrol data. . Locking. Obyek-obyek Oracle (Views, clusters, indexes, synonyms, snapshots)

INDIKATOR
Restriksi, sorting, rules, defaults dan constraining data dilakukan. Sub-queries dan corelated queries dibuat. Ekstensi dari DML (Data Manipulation Language) dan DDL (Data Definition Language) dijelaskan. Fitur-fitur dan perintah dalam SQL*plus digunakan . Perintah manipulasi data dan kontrol data digunakan. Locking dijelaskan.

PENILAIAN
Program sederhana Pengamatan Tes tertulis Tugas Hasil program

TM
4

PS
4 (8) -

PI

SUMBER BELAJAR
Buku Oracle Komputer Jobsheet Modul ajar PL/SQL

PROGRAM KEAHLIAN : REKAYASA PERANGKAT LUNAK

SILABUS KOMPETENSI KEJURUAN Halaman 3 dari 5

KURIKULUM SMK Pasundan Cilamaya

KOMPETENSI DASAR

MATERI PEMBELAJARAN
Explicit dan implicit cursors, exception, procedures, functions dan triggers. Konsep data dictionary dijelaskan

ALOKASI WAKTU KEGIATAN PEMBELAJARAN


Membuat Explicit dan implicit cursors, exception, procedures, functions dan triggers. Menjelaskan Konsep data

INDIKATOR
Obyek-obyek Oracle (Views, clusters, indexes, synonyms, snapshots) dijelaskan Explicit dan implicit cursors, exception, procedures, functions dan triggers dibuat. Konsep data dictionary dijelaskan Variable Character Set dan Tipe Data dijelaskan Komponen PL/SQL dijelaskan Cursor processing dijelaskan PL/SQL Tables dan PL/SQL Wrappers digunakan

PENILAIAN

TM

PS

PI

SUMBER BELAJAR

2. Menerapkan PL/SQL Variable Character Set dan Tipe Data Komponen PL/SQL Cursor processing PL/SQL Tables dan PL/SQL Wrappers Menjelaskan Variable Character Set dan Tipe Data Menjelaskan Komponen PL/SQL Menjelaskan Cursor processing Menggunakan PL/SQL Tables dan PL/SQL Wrappers

Program sederhana Pengamatan Tes tertulis Tugas Hasil program

8 (16)

Buku Oracle Komputer Jobsheet Modul ajar PL/SQL

PROGRAM KEAHLIAN : REKAYASA PERANGKAT LUNAK

SILABUS KOMPETENSI KEJURUAN Halaman 4 dari 5

KURIKULUM SMK Pasundan Cilamaya

KOMPETENSI DASAR
3. Menerapkan Oracle tingkat lanjut

INDIKATOR
Flow proses CASE dilakukan PL/SQL record ke dalam DML direferensikan Bulk binding dihasilkan Run-time dynamic SQL dijelaskan

MATERI PEMBELAJARAN
Variable Character Set dan Tipe Data Komponen PL/SQL Cursor processing PL/SQL Tables dan PL/SQL Wrappers digunakan

ALOKASI WAKTU KEGIATAN PEMBELAJARAN


Menjelaskan Variable Character Set dan Tipe Data Menjelaskan Komponen PL/SQL Mengaplikasikan Cursor processing Menggunakan PL/SQL Tables dan PL/SQL Wrappers

PENILAIAN
Program sederhana Pengamatan Tes tertulis Tugas Hasil program 6 6 (12)

SUMBER BELAJAR
Buku Oracle Komputer Jobsheet Modul ajar PL/SQL

Keterangan
TM PS PI : Tatap Muka : Praktek di Sekolah (2 jam praktik di sekolah setara dengan 1 jam tatap muka) : Praktek di Industri (4 jam praktik di Du/ Di setara dengan 1 jam tatap muka)

PROGRAM KEAHLIAN : REKAYASA PERANGKAT LUNAK

SILABUS KOMPETENSI KEJURUAN Halaman 5 dari 5

You might also like